Geological and Cultural Significance

Formed over millions of years through groundwater dissolving limestone, the Chinhoyi Caves represent a "mysterious labyrinth" of underground chambers. These caves hold deep cultural resonance; they are regarded by the indigenous people as a "sacred place" and a vital "connection to our ancestors." The caves are not merely a natural site but a historical one, traditionally utilized for spiritual and ritual purposes, making the atmosphere one of profound reverence.
